This green extra tough mouthing therapy tool is constructed of a non‐toxic medical grade, latex FREE material, that is chewy and resilient. Designed for individuals who need to exert lots of pressure, yet need the opportunity for jaw movement, tongue movement, and oral exploration as well. The handle makes it easy for little hands to hold and manipulate.
Material and color are FDA‐approved and made in the USA. Specially designed with no holes or crevices that could harbor bacteria or saliva.Use with adult supervision.

The sensory brush, also known as the "corn brush" is firm and is the preferred brush for the Wilbarger Protocol brushing program. Ideal for clinic or home use. For specific brushing techniques, speak with an occupational therapist.

Exercise and balance discs have a dual use. They can be used for sitting to give you the same benefits as sitting on an exercise ball. They are used in exercise to provide an unstable surface, forcing you to use more muscles to remain balanced thus getting a more complete workout.
►Parents and teachers also report great success using them as a "wiggle seat" to help calm children who have a hard time sitting still.
